Section 27-51-1205 - Soliciting rides

Ask AI about this
No person shall stand in a roadway for the purpose of soliciting a ride from the driver of any private vehicle.Acts 1937, No. 300, § 79; Pope's Dig., § 6737; A.S.A. 1947, § 75-630.
